The Regional Sales Manager will be responsible for driving and generating distinct revenue within assigned accounts. To meet this objective, the incumbent will be required to develop and maintain multi-level cross-departmental Customer relationships. This individual will continuously develop and bring to fruition an opportunity pipeline that identifies Customer requirements as well as how Samsung will meet them. Regular meetings with Customers will serve to establish the Regional manager as a trusted advisor who can effectively communicate Samsung’s vision. A particular emphasis will be placed on knowledge of and the effective communication of Consumer Electronics industry trends in relation to Samsung’s product portfolio. Success in this role will be measured on attainment of revenue and profit targets and overall creation of sales demand.

Role and Responsibilities
- Responsible for building sales growth for Regional Accounts in the Quebec region.
- Meet regularly with new and existing customers to become a trusted advisor who can effectively communicate Samsung’s vision.
- Develop an opportunity pipeline that identifies Customer requirements as well as how Samsung will meet them.
- Review and revise plans monthly, working with Samsung Marketing to maximize sales within each Regional Account.
- Plan sku listings, targets, budgets, advertising, promotions, etc.
- Gather weekly product forecast by model by dealer and ensure inventory forecast matches promotional calendar by account.
- Reduce account to account friction by careful calendar/promotion/sku schedule.
- Control territory sales expenses in accordance with Company guidelines. In store support for locations including weekly store visits as well as training.
- Collaborate with all accounts on joint business planning, brand management, in-store merchandising and retail sales execution.
